Indeed, Amazon's stock has been performing well -- at least relative to other e-commerce companies such as eBay (Nasdaq: EBAY) -- something that it strategically leveraged in this deal, according to Boston University's Venkatraman. It's a judicious use of an attractively priced stock as the currency to acquire critical capabilities, he said. Using stock to pay for the acquisition also sat well with Zappos, whose management team apparently requested that, added Gunster's Bates. It "demonstrates that Zappos' management also believe this transaction adds tremendous value to Amazon."
